DGETMW: Motion Video Tracking Based on Memory Watershed Disc Gradient Expansion Template

Abstract: In order to obtain ideal detection results of moving object, a new video moving object detection algorithm based on labeling watershed and detection algorithm and morphology were proposed. The image was pre-processed by diffusion model to eliminate noise interference on object detection, and the difference algorithm was used to extract outline of moving object.. Morphological operations were used to process the target outline, and marked watershed algorithm was used to segment moving object and performance was tested by simulation experiments. The simulation results show that the proposed algorithm can prevent over segmentation problems and accurately detect moving object from complex background, not only improve the detection accuracy but accelerate the speed of moving object detection.
